<div dir="ltr">I am not think the debian borg are crazy because they  have svn-buildpackage, cvs-buildpackage, git-buildpackage<br>from years(<a href="http://honk.sigxcpu.org/projects/git-buildpackage/manual-html/gbp.html">http://honk.sigxcpu.org/projects/git-buildpackage/manual-html/gbp.html</a>). Doesn't exists a rpm equivalent - or<br>
better an rpmbuild integration with vcs - only because of rpm fragmentation and, i think, because every other distro want a <br>competive advantage in using the their "buildsystem". But, in 2008, it is time to gave to all the rpm packager an unified vcs integration with RPM<br>
<br>JMHO, YMMV<br><br><br><br><div class="gmail_quote">On Wed, Jul 23, 2008 at 9:43 AM, Hans de Goede <<a href="mailto:j.w.r.degoede@hhs.nl">j.w.r.degoede@hhs.nl</a>> wrote:<br><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">
<div class="Ih2E3d">Doug Ledford wrote:<br>
<bl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">
I've been working on getting this set up and functional.<br>
</blockquote>
<br></div>
<lots of complicated hacks and workarounds deleted><br>
<br>
So Far I've been quiet on this, sort of hoping it would go away by itself, but as a contributor with quite a few packages let me say that I'm deeply worried about this whole distributed VCS / exploded source idea floating around.<br>

<br>
It seems there are a few people who are a big fan of this, and about as much active opponents. I have no problems with adding the possibility to use a distributed VCS with exploded trees to the mix of ways to maintain and build packages, but this should not replace the current nice and simple setup we have.<br>

<br>
First of all it does NOT match the way rpm was designed at all, rpm is about pristine sources with _separate_ patches, but most importantly, this is rather complicated making things unnecessary hard for people who don't want to do the stuff some of the distributed VCS proponents want to do. This worries me, I'm esp. worried that the barrier of entry to becoming a Fedora packager will be raised significantly.<br>

<br>
Also I even fail to see the claimed advantages in using a distributed VCS at all, isn't our mantra upstream upstream upstream, well if this mantra is properly followed and upstream is undergoing active development then most of the time the pristine sources should be fine without any patches at all, since all patches are integrated upstream in a timely manner. Also if someone wants to do so much work on the upstrewam sources, then he/she should just become an upstream developer. Really getting upstream cvs/svn/whatever access isn't that hard, then one can directly commit one's changes in to upstreams VCS.<br>

<br>
Regards,<br>
<br>
Hans<br><font color="#888888">
<br>
-- <br>
fedora-devel-list mailing list<br>
<a href="mailto:fedora-devel-list@redhat.com" target="_blank">fedora-devel-list@redhat.com</a><br>
<a href="https://www.redhat.com/mailman/listinfo/fedora-devel-list" target="_blank">https://www.redhat.com/mailman/listinfo/fedora-devel-list</a><br>
</font></blockquote></div><br></div>